Man, in the time it takes to do a gif on the first day of full workouts for the Cubs, lots can change.
Like Matt Garza feeling a twinge in his lat (below the left shoulderblade) and having to leave practice.
When I was making the art, I figured (as many do) that if Garza stays healthy and shows he can pitch, he'd be gone before ST was over.
Now, they say there's no real reason to panic about Garza - they're stressing that it's a "minor" tweak.
But of course, last year I believe the injury that kept him out for half the season was first called a "cramp".
Aneewhoooooo, lets take a look at the current 40-man:
You can see, Wood is one of 4 lefties on that whole list.
But Brooks Raley and Chris Rusin don't figure to be major leaguers this year, so in reality Wood is one of 2 lefties, and the other is important setup reliever James Russell.
So even before the Garza thing yesterday...we all heard Dale Sveum say he thought Scott Baker would be fully recovered by about week one, so the starters would be Samardzija, Jackson, Scott Feldman, Garza and Baker.
All righties, and one lefty reliever?
Seems weird, man - I just figure that one way or another Wood will be around in week one, and probably around should Garza get traded.
I feel bad for Hector Villanueva, but unless he looks WAY better than Wood, Wood gets the nod.
